Patient-Reported Outcomes in CARDiology (PROCARD) og QUALity of care in CARDiology (QUALCARD) is a research group at Department of Heart Disease, Haukeland University Hospital.

 Research group leader

Tone Norekvål
 

Tone M. Norekvål’s main position is at the Department of Heart Disease, Haukeland University Hospital, were she chairs the PROCARD research group. She is a registered nurse with a masters degree in nursing science and a PhD from the Faculty of Medicine at the University of Bergen. Norekvål holds a position as Professor II at the Department of Clinical Science, University of Bergen and at the Department of Health and Caring Sciences, Western Norway University of Applied Sciences. In addition, she is a special advisor at the Center on Patient-reported Outcomes at Haukeland University Hospital.

Norekvål has extensive leadership and project management experience from various positions at the Department of Heart Disease, as former chair of the Norwegian Nurses Association Society of Cardiovascular Nurses (NSF-LKS), former chair of the Council of Cardiovascular Nursing and Allied Professions, and member of the Education Committee and the Oversight Committee in the European Society of Cardiology (ESC). In addition, Norekvål has participated in several ESC Task Forces and contributed on development of ESC Guidelines. Furthermore, Norekvål holds several national appointed positions, such as board member in the Norwegian Council on Cardiovascular Disease and the Norwegian Heart Failure Registry. Norekvål is associated editor of the European Journal of Cardiovascular Nursing and editorial board member in Cardiology.

Teaching and supervision
Norekvål teaches at the Master Program in Clinical Nursing (Cardiovascular Nursing), at the Western Norway University of Applied Sciences. She has been main supervisor for more than 20 completed master degrees in clinical nursing and radiography, and several more are ongoing. Norekvål has been main supervisor on four completed PhD-thesis, and is main supervisor for six ongoing PhD-candidates.

Research interest
Tone M. Norekvål initiated and chairs the PROCARD research group at the Department of Heart Disease. Her research is mainly linked to patient-reported outcome measures (PRO) and cardiac patients and includes patients with coronary artery disease, arrhythmia, valvular disease and heart failure. In addition, Norekvål chairs the research programme on patient-reported data in the Helse-Bergen Health Trust.
